Maitland halfback Brock Lamb has been named the club's first-grade player of the year for the 2025 season, in which they won a record fourth straight Newcastle RL premiership.
Lamb adds the club award to the Newcastle RL player of the year award in a season, Pickers coach Matt Lantry said, had proved beyond doubt Lamb is one of the toughest and most talented players in the competition.
A sickness in the family prevented Lamb from attending the awards night at which Pickers favourites Matt Soper-Lawler and Chad O'Donnell were presented with life membership.
Lamb also won the best back award, while Pickers skipper Sam Anderson won the best forwards, and hooker Harrison Spruce won the coveted players' player award.
